
Clubs and Activities
St Bede’s is a busy school and there is a wide range of extra curricular activities going on both in the afternoons and early evenings.
The children can choose their activities at the start of each term and stay in that activity throughout the term. Sometimes specialist teachers are required and a range of specialists come to school to boost our programme.
A selection of the large number of activities on offer are shown below. Please note that some activities are only available at certain times during the day.

There is a small surcharge for evening activities although supper is provided for these children.
Junior Years Activity Programme
We run a comprehensive activity programme for the children in the Junior Years.
Children in Years 3 and 4 can choose to remain after the end of the school day and join in these activities. Year 5 children have a longer school day and the activity programme is a part of the timetable.
The choice of activities on offer changes during the course of the year and the number of outdoor activities increases during the summer term to take advantage of the lighter evenings. During the summer term Year 5 pupils can also choose to join in the late evening activity programme.
